They’re fighting for a place on Love Island after being left single in the last explosive recoupling.
And Chuggs and Brad were sure to lay it on thick and try to impress new girl Rachel ahead of her big decision on who to couple up with, which is set to air on Sunday.
Rachel, 29, entered the villa on Friday and was told she had just 24 hours to get to know both boys – with one hunk set to be dumped from the island.
